With the rollout of the 'Next G' network into even the most remote communities in the Northern Territory, more and more Indigenous people are using state of the art technologies to communicate, organise their lives and share information. Petra Mayerhofer, a visiting research intern from Austria, is investigating how mobile phones, laptops and the Internet are changing people's lives in Indigenous communities, especially in relation to temporary mobility.
